I love hiring people with no experience because I can mould them to be model employees.
No experience many times means, no bad habits to break, no " this is how we did it at my last job" BS and no confusion about goals and training. That being said, proper training is expensive, therefore some prior experience may shorten that curve. It is a battle all leaders fight, and the trainees too.
